5. "What are the nine clear signs Allah gave to Musa (AS) while he was with Firaun and his people?           

Answer: Nine signs (proofs) which Firaun's people faced are:

 1. Stick (his staff) turning to snake.

2. Radiant hand of Musa.

3. Year of drought and Shortness of fruits.

4. The flood.

5. Locust.

6. Lice.

7. Frogs.

8. Blood.

9. The splitting of sea.

Several things are also suggested as a sign:

                 -  Years of drought and Shortness of fruits were taken by                       some as two separate signs.

                 -  Equal authority and Prophet hood is granted to                                  brother Harun (AS).

                 -  Tyrant Firaun cannot harm or kill Musa (AS) even                             though he tried often

                 -  The public defeat of sorcery.

                 -  Strong faith developed by Magicians.

                 - Destruction of Qaroon’s wealth.

 "And indeed We gave to Musa (AS) nine clear signs. Ask then the Children of Israel, when he came to them, then Fir'aun said to him: "O Musa! I think you are indeed bewitched." (17:101). Musa (AS) said: "Verily, you know that these signs have been sent down by none but the Lord of the heavens and the earth as clear.  And I think you are, indeed, O Firaun doomed to destruction!" (17:102)

These clear signs according to Ibn Abbas were: his staff, his hand, the years of famine, the sea, the flood, the locusts, the lice, the frogs and the blood. Muhammad bin Ka`b said, "They were his hand and his staff, the five signs mentioned in Al-A`raf, and destruction of wealth and the rock.'' Mujahid, Ikrimah, Ash-Shabi and Qatadah said: "They are his hand, his staff, the years of famine, the failure of the crops, the flood, the locusts, the lice, the frogs and the blood.''

The verses that proove the first two signs are:

 Allah said: "Cast your stick down, O Musa!". He cast it down, and behold! It was a snake, moving quickly.

Allah said: "Grasp it, and fear not, We shall return it to its former state'' "And press your (right) hand to your (left) side, it will come forth white (and shining), without any disease as another sign'' (20:19 to 22)

 The same is repeated in 31 and 32 verses of 28 th Sura Al-Qases and "Put your hand in your bosom, it will come forth white without a disease, and draw your hand close to your side to be free from fear (that which you suffered from the snake, and also by that your hand will return to its original state). these are two Burhan (signs, miracles, evidences, proofs) from your Lord to Fir'aun and his chiefs. (28:32).

The third sign:

 "And indeed We punished the people of Fir'aun with years of drought and shortness of fruits (crops, etc.), that they might remember (take heed)." (7:130). Some Scholars say that these are two separate signs.

The next five signs are:

They said to Musa (AS): "Whatever Ayat you may bring to us, to work there- with your sorcery on us, we shall never believe in you." (7:132). So We sent on them: the flood, the locusts, the lice, the frogs, and the blood (as a succession of) manifest signs but they persisted in arrogance and were a wicked people." (7:133). When tormented, they pleaded, “O Moses! Pray to your Lord on our behalf, by virtue of the covenant He made with you. If you help remove this torment from us, we will certainly believe in you and let the Children of Israel go with you.” (7:134).

But as soon as We removed the torment from them—until they met their inevitable fate, they broke their promise. So We inflicted punishment upon them, drowning them in the sea for denying Our signs and being heedless of them. In this way the noble Word of your Lord was fulfilled for the Children of Israel for what they had endured. And We destroyed what Pharaoh and his people constructed and what they established. (7:135 to 137)

Splitting of Red Sea:

 Ibn Abbas listed the partition of Red Sea as a sign. Allah himself mentioned it as as a sign. “So We inspired Moses: ‘Strike the sea with your staff’, and the sea was split, each part was like a huge mountain. We drew the pursuers to that place, and delivered Moses and those with him all together. Then We drowned the others. Surely in this is a sign. Yet most of them would not believe. (26: 62 to 67). The other verses are: "strike a dry path for them in the sea” (20:77). "We separated the sea for you and saved you and drowned Fir'aun's  people"(2:50).

Several things are also suggested as signs:

Muhammad bin Kab listed destruction of Qaroon’s wealth as a sign. After seeing the serpent from Musa’s staff, the magicians realized the truth from Allah, so said to Firaun, “By the One Who created us! We will never prefer you over the clear proofs (sign) that have come to us. So do whatever you want! Your authority only covers the fleeting life of this world. Indeed, we have believed in our Lord so He may forgive our sins and that magic you have forced us to practice. And Allah is far superior in reward and more lasting in punishment.” (20:73 and 74).  Some suggesting that the strong faith of the magicians as one of the sign.  From the following ayath “We will assist you with your brother and, so they cannot harm you. With Our signs, you and those who follow you will certainly prevail.” (28:35), it was suggested that Allah gave equal power to his brother Harun also. The tyrant Firaun cannot kill them both because of Allah’s protection.  Some say that this is one of Allah’s signs.

Musa (AS) was the only Prophet who brought so many signs from Allah. Even for the Children of Israel Allah showed so many signs while/after leaving Egypt. After Pharaoh was dead, his effect still remained

in the blood of the Children of Israel. Their attitude was not good. They were reluctant to fight to enter into Holy Land.  They took long period of time to recover. Musa (AS) prayed to Allah to judge between himself and his people. Allah made forbidden the Holy Land to them for forty years. That generation died and the next generation came who could fight and got victory. Allah showed many signs to them. They are the following:

 1. Musa’s Lord talked to him directly in this world. (4:164).

2. Musa’s Lord appeared on the mountain. (7:143).

3. Raised the mount Sinai (2:63, 93; 4:154; 7:171).

4. Twelve streams of water spring from rock. (7:160).

5. Clouds of shade (7:160).

6. Manna & Salwa (7:160).

7. Raising the dead with part of a slaughtered cow. (2:73)

8. Raising up the Children of Israel after death. (2:55 & 56).

9. Receiving the written tablets of Taura directly from Allah (7:144)


 1. Musa’s Lord spoke directly to Musa (AS) in this world:

" And when Musa (AS) came the time and place appointed by Us, and his Lord spoke to him directly.'' (4:164). Of course Allah talked to Adam (AS) and the Prophet Mohammed (ﷺ) in the heaven. Allah said: "O Moses, I have chosen you above men by My Messages, and by My speaking to you. So hold that which I have given you and be of the grateful." (7:144).

2. Musa’s Lord appeared on the mountain:

Musa (AS) said: "O my Lord! Show me (yourself), that I may look upon You." Allah said: "You cannot see Me, but look upon the mountain if it stands still in its place then you shall see Me." So when his Lord appeared to the mountain, He made it collapse to dust, and Musa(AS) fell down unconscious. Then when he recovered his senses he said: "Glory be to You, I turn to You in repentance and I am the first of the believers." (7:143).

3. Raised the mount Sinai:

 And when We took your covenant and raised the mountain above you saying, “Hold firmly to that Scripture which We have given you and obey,” (2:63 and 93). And remember when We raised the mountain over them as if it were a cloud and they thought it would fall on them. (7:171). We raised the Mount over them as a warning for breaking their covenant (4:154). 

4,5,6. Twelve streams of water from rock, clouds of shade, Manna & Salwa:

" We divided them into twelve tribes (as distinct) nations. We directed Musa (AS) by inspiration, when his people asked him for water, (saying): "Strike the stone with your stick", and there gushed forth out of it twelve springs: each group knew its own place for water. We shaded them with the clouds and sent down upon them Al-Manna and the quails ...." (7:160).

7. Raising the dead with part of a slaughtered cow:

We said: "Strike him (the dead man) with a piece of it (the slaughtered cow)." Thus Allah brings the dead to life and shows you His Ayat so that you may understand. (2:73).

8. Raising up the Children of Israel after death:

 And (remember) when the Children of Israel said: "O Musa (AS)! We shall never believe in you till we see Allah plainly." But you were seized with a lightning, while you were looking: Then We raised you up after your death so that you might be grateful.” (2:55 & 56).

9. Receiving written tablets of Taura:

“And We wrote for him on the Tablets, the lesson to be drawn from all things and the explanation of all things (and said): "hold unto these with firmness, and enjoin your people to take the better therein,” (7:145).
